ROCHESTER, N.Y. (WHEC) — A portion of Lake Avenue remains shut down following a fiery two-car crash Monday morning.

Rochester Police went to the scene on Lake Avenue near Lorimer Street around 6 a.m.

When crews go to the scene, they found at least one car on fire, with a man still inside. Firefighters were able to get the man out. He was taken to Strong Memorial Hospital and is expected to survive. The other driver was also taken to strong is also expected to survive.

Police are still looking into what caused the crash.

Lake, between Phelps and Jones Avenues, is still closed.
